Gain insight into the importance of, and the need for awareness, prevention, and intervention to assist individuals and families that experience a Perinatal Mood and/or Anxiety Disorder. You will discuss and understand the definitions, prevalence, and stigmatization surrounding this population, and review current research, assessment, and treatment strategies for people with maternal and paternal perinatal mood and anxiety disorders (PMADS). This course is approved for 3 CEUs by the NV Board of Examiners for Social Workers and the NV Board of Examiners for MFTs & CPCs.
